The contract calls for the procurement of steel poles measuring 100 feet in length with a minimum torsional capacity of 486 ft-kips at ground level, equivalent to Class H4 standards. These poles must be hot dipped galvanized in compliance with ASTM A123 to ensure corrosion resistance and durability. All design details, drilling patterns, and fabrication must strictly follow the latest version of the NES Specification LSK-1230 to guarantee uniformity and structural integrity. Only approved manufacturers and specific part numbers are acceptable, including DIS-TRAN100H4, FTWORTH100H4, MDHENRY100H4, ROHN100H4, SABRECO100H4, THOMAS-B100H4, V&SSCHU100H4, VALMONT100H4, CHMALLSTEELPOLES, and TAPPALLSTEELPOLES. The solicitation, issued under reference number Z4916 by Nashville Electric Service in Tennessee, is targeted toward state and local government entities and remains open for responses until August 14, 2026, with all deliveries and performance expected to occur in Nashville, Tennessee.
